A cli for creating, starting, building, deploying and publishing Fusion apps and tiles
A cli for creating, starting, building, deploying and publishing Fusion apps and tiles
$ npm install -g @equinor/fusion-cli
$ fusion COMMAND
running command...
$ fusion (-v|--version|version)
@equinor/fusion-cli/0.0.8 linux-x64 node-v11.1.0
$ fusion --help [COMMAND]

fusion build-appBuild the app as a ready-to-deply zip bundle
USAGE
$ fusion build-app
OPTIONS
-o, --out=out [default: ./out] Output path
-s, --silent No console output
-z, --[no-]zip Generate zip
See code: src/commands/build-app.ts
fusion create-appCreates a new fusion app
USAGE
$ fusion create-app
OPTIONS
-N, --shortName=shortName App short name
-d, --description=description App description
-g, --git Initialize git repository
-h, --help show CLI help
-i, --install Install dev dependencies
-k, --key=key Key for app/tile
-n, --name=name Name for app/tile(use quotes for spaces)
See code: src/commands/create-app.ts

fusion start-appStart a fusion app
USAGE
$ fusion start-app
OPTIONS
-P, --production Use production config
-a, --apps=apps Compile one or more fusion apps. E.g. --apps AppKey1 AppKey2 AppKey3
-h, --help show CLI help
-p, --progress Display build progress
See code: src/commands/start-app.ts
